What Makes Concord Real Estate Unique
Concord holds a special position in the Charlotte metro’s real estate landscape. Its growth has been driven by two powerful forces: the I-85 retail and logistics corridor that stretches from Charlotte through Cabarrus County, and the motorsports industry ecosystem centered around Charlotte Motor Speedway. These engines have drawn significant population and investment — while also creating a housing market with unusual dynamics.
Median home prices in Concord typically range from $280,000 to $380,000 for standard single-family homes, with newer construction in master-planned communities pushing higher and older properties in transitional neighborhoods pulling lower. The gap between updated homes and those needing work can be dramatic — $80,000 to $120,000 in some neighborhoods — which is exactly why selling as-is to a cash buyer often makes financial sense even at a slight discount to market value.
Concord has absorbed significant apartment and single-family construction in recent years, expanding the housing supply. For sellers with dated homes competing against brand-new builds, a cash sale to an investor sidesteps that competition entirely.
Concord’s proximity to Charlotte — roughly 20-25 minutes to Uptown via I-85 — keeps demand strong from commuters who want more space for less money than Charlotte proper provides. That underlying demand is good news for sellers with well-positioned properties, but it doesn’t help when time is the issue.

How does selling to you compare to listing with a Concord realtor?
A traditional listing in Concord might fetch a higher gross sale price — but subtract 5-6% in commissions, potential repair costs, price reductions after inspection, carrying costs for 60-90 days, and the uncertainty of a deal falling through, and the net difference is often smaller than sellers expect.
